This package implements the procedures of [Traction Force Microscopy](https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/11832345) and [Monolayer Stress Microscopy](https://journals.plos.org/plosone/article?id=10.1371/journal.pone.0055172). In addition to the standard measures for stress and force generation, it\nalso includes the line tension, a measure for the force transfer exclusively across cell-cell boundaries. \npyTFM includes an addon for the image annotation tool [clickpoints](https://clickpoints.readthedocs.io/en/latest/) allowing you to quickly analyze and vizualize large datasets.\n\nPlease refer to the [Documentation](https://pytfm.readthedocs.io/en/latest/) of pyTFM for detailed instructions on installation and usage.\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Ffabrylab%2FpyTFM","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Ffabrylab%2FpyTFM","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Ffabrylab%2FpyTFM/lists"}
